#c4c9e9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c4c9e9 is composed of 76.9% red, 78.8% green and 91.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 15.9% cyan, 13.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 231.9 degrees, a saturation of 45.7% and a lightness of 84.1%. #c4c9e9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#8993d3. Closest websafe color is: #ccccff.

#c4c9e9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c4c9e9 has RGB values of R:196, G:201, B:233 and CMYK values of C:0.16, M:0.14, Y:0,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 12896745.
